About the role:
Working across different stages of the production line, you will be responsible for carrying out hands-on inspections of materials, components and finished products. You will use drawings, specifications and measuring equipment to ensure products meet the required standards. As a Quality Inspector, you will also be one of the first points of contact when defects are identified, working directly with production teams to resolve quality issues.
Key Responsibilities
Inspecting materials, components and finished products against technical drawings and specifications
Carrying out in-process quality checks throughout production
Recording measurements, defects and corrective actions accurately
Identifying and quarantining non-conforming products
Supporting root-cause investigations and corrective actions
